How To Fix CCMM132 - At least one error occurred during attempted notification creation


CCMM132 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CCMM - Message Class for A&D CCM

  • Message number: 132

  • Message text: At least one error occurred during attempted notification creation

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    While trying to create or update a notification on database, the system
    delivered at least one message with a grave error.

    System Response

    The process is terminated. The system cannot save your entries.

    How to fix this error?

    View the application log and verify all error messages. You can either
    try to correct the error, if possible, or activate the "Forced
    Installation/Removal Mode" to overrule the check results. In either case
    , save your entries again to restart the removal/ installation process.
